Amazon defines a region as a geographical area in which there are at least three separate data centers, called Availability Zones (AZs). The most basic difference between fault tolerance and high availability is this: A fault-tolerant environment has no service interruption but a significantly higher cost, while a highly available environment has a minimum service interruption but less cost. Failover is basically a backup operational mode in which the functions of a system component are assumed by a secondary system in the event that the primary one goes offline, either due to failure or planned down time. The total availability of a system of sequentially connected components is the product of individual availabilities. In the event of an infrastructure (AZ) failure, Amazon RDS automatically switches to the backup database instance in the separate AZ. In each region, AZs are separated by a meaningful distance, but no more than 100 km, to allow for fast connectivity between them. RDS automatically promotes an existing Aurora Replica to be the new primary replica and changes server endpoints in the event of a primary replica failure in a DB cluster, allowing your application to continue running without human intervention. Amazon RDS The Multi-AZ feature of Amazon RDS operates two databases in multiple Availability Zones with synchronous replication, thus creating a highly available environment with automatic failover. Horizontal scaling offers more room to grow and better cost efficiency, but introduces additional level of complexity, requiring higher level of operational maturity and high degree of automation. Amazon AZs are interconnected with high-bandwidth, low-latency networking, over a dedicated metro fiber cable. Amazon RDS Multi-AZ Deployments: In Multi-AZ deployments, Amazon RDS automatically generates a primary DB instance and synchronously replicates the data to a standby instance in a separate AZ.
